Output 41a23d87f7dd635f2ce59ca6af744bec35b3a8265c13e8da1232e61d3300bcda:0

value
274288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5b8f50deec5ab199c2ef9d0c75ab0a29c639828 OP_EQUAL
address
3MB5RTXjnBM134qtjQqceHea9f6sQy2hFY
transaction
41a23d87f7dd635f2ce59ca6af744bec35b3a8265c13e8da1232e61d3300bcda
confirmations
351878
spent
true